When it involves seeking treatment for addiction or mental health points, one of many critical choices you will face is whether or not to opt for an Intensive Outpatient Program (IOP) or inpatient rehab. Each options supply distinct advantages and cater to totally different wants, making it essential to understand the variations and decide which is the fitting choice for you or your loved one.  
  
Intensive Outpatient Program (IOP):  
  
An Intensive Outpatient Program (IOP) is a structured treatment approach that enables individuals to obtain remedy and support while still residing at home. It's a wonderful alternative for those who want assistance in managing their addiction or mental health issues however can preserve a level of independence and stability outside of a treatment facility.  
  
Listed here are some key features and benefits of IOP:  
  
1. Flexibility: IOPs typically supply flexible scheduling, allowing participants to attend therapy classes and treatment activities during the day or evening. This flexibility can accommodate work, school, or family commitments.  
  
2. Continued Independence: You can proceed dwelling at home and keep your every day routines, which might be essential for these with family responsibilities or different obligations.  
  
3. Price-Efficient: IOPs are typically more cost-effective than inpatient rehab because they don't require the same level of residential care.  
  
4. Robust Support System: While in an IOP, you'll have access to a assist network of therapists, counselors, and peers who can provide steerage and encouragement as you work by your challenges.  
  
Inpatient Rehab:  
  
Inpatient rehabilitation programs, additionally known as residential treatment programs, provide a more immersive and intensive approach to addiction or mental health treatment. Individuals admitted to inpatient rehab facilities live on-site for a specified period, typically starting from 28 days to a number of months.  
  
Here are some key options and benefits of inpatient rehab:  
  
1. 24/7 Supervision: Inpatient rehab offers spherical-the-clock medical and therapeutic support, guaranteeing that individuals obtain fixed care and supervision throughout probably the most critical levels of their recovery.  
  
2. Structured Environment: Being in a controlled and structured environment may be particularly useful for these with severe addiction or mental health issues. It removes external triggers and distractions, permitting individuals to focus solely on their recovery.  
  
3. Intensive Therapy: Inpatient rehab provides more frequent and intensive therapy sessions, including individual counseling, group remedy, and specialised programs tailored to each individual's needs.  
  
4. Peer Help: Living in shut quarters with others who are additionally working toward recovery can foster a strong sense of camaraderie and peer help, which can be invaluable during the rehabilitation process.  
  
Which Is the Proper Selection for You?  
  
The choice between an IOP and inpatient rehab ought to be based mostly on several factors, including the severity of the addiction or mental health challenge, individual needs, and personal circumstances. Here are some guidelines that can assist you make the correct alternative:  
  
Select Inpatient Rehab if:  
  
You've a severe addiction or mental health challenge that requires intensive treatment and 24/7 support.  
Your residing environment shouldn't be conducive to recovery, as it is filled with triggers or negative influences.  
You've got previously tried outpatient treatment without success and want a more structured approach.  
Choose IOP if:  
  
You've gotten a powerful help system at residence and can maintain your each day responsibilities.  
Your addiction or mental health problem isn't extreme and might be managed with regular therapy and support.  
You prefer a more flexible treatment schedule that permits you to proceed working or attending school.  
Ultimately, the precise alternative for you will rely on your unique circumstances and the steerage of medical professionals. It is essential to seek the advice of with a healthcare provider or addiction specialist who can assess your needs and recommend probably the most appropriate level of care.  
  
In conclusion, both Intensive Outpatient Programs (IOPs) and inpatient rehab have their advantages, and the choice needs to be based mostly on individual circumstances. Crucial factor is to seek assist when wanted and commit to the recovery process, regardless of the treatment setting chosen. Do not forget that recovery is a personal journey, and the fitting choice is the one that supports your path to lasting health and well-being.
